When selecting a cleaner for laminate floors, understanding key factors can help you avoid damage and achieve the best results. Laminate surfaces are sensitive to excess moisture and harsh chemicals, so choosing the right product is essential for maintaining their appearance and durability. Consider how often you’ll clean, your preference for natural ingredients, and whether you need a product that works on multiple surfaces. These factors will guide you toward the most suitable cleaner for your home.Effectiveness and Dirt Removal
Choose a cleaner that effectively lifts dirt, dust, and stains without requiring excessive scrubbing. Some products use stronger surfactants, while others rely on gentle formulas suitable for daily use. Keep in mind that overly aggressive cleaners can damage the laminate’s finish, so look for those that specify safe use on laminate surfaces. A good cleaner strikes a balance—powerful enough to clean, yet gentle enough to preserve the floor’s integrity.
Ease of Use and Application
Consider whether the cleaner comes in a spray bottle, concentrate, or refill container. Spray bottles offer quick, targeted cleaning, ideal for spot treatments, while refills often provide better value for frequent use. Concentrates can be more economical but require mixing, which might be inconvenient. A user-friendly design reduces hassle and encourages consistent cleaning routines, helping you keep your floors looking their best with minimal effort.
Eco-Friendliness and Ingredients
Natural ingredients appeal to environmentally conscious consumers and often contain fewer chemicals that could harm your laminate. However, eco-friendly formulas might need more frequent applications or may not be as potent on stubborn stains. Conversely, some traditional cleaners contain stronger chemicals that can be more effective but may emit stronger scents or pose health concerns. Consider your priorities—safety, scent, and cleaning power—when choosing an eco-conscious or conventional product.
Scent and Residue
A pleasant scent can make cleaning more enjoyable, but some fragrances may be overpowering or irritating. Clear, streak-free finishes are also important for appearance, especially in visible areas. Avoid cleaners that leave a sticky residue or film, as these can attract more dirt over time. Look for products explicitly designed for laminate floors that emphasize streak-free and residue-free results to maintain a polished look.
Value and Versatility
Refill bottles and multi-surface formulas often provide better value, especially if you have multiple types of flooring. However, highly versatile cleaners may sacrifice some specialized cleaning power needed for stubborn stains. Decide if you prefer a dedicated laminate floor cleaner that emphasizes gentle, effective cleaning or a multi-surface product that simplifies your routine. Your budget and cleaning frequency will influence this choice, so weigh cost against long-term convenience and results.
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use regular all-purpose cleaner on laminate floors?
Regular all-purpose cleaners often contain chemicals that can damage laminate surfaces over time, especially if they are too harsh or leave a residue. It’s better to select a cleaner specifically formulated for laminate floors, as these are designed to be gentle yet effective. Using the wrong cleaner can lead to dulling, warping, or peeling of the laminate finish, so always check the label to confirm compatibility.
How often should I clean my laminate floors?
For most homes, cleaning laminate floors once a week is sufficient to remove dust and prevent buildup. Spills and stains should be addressed immediately with a damp cloth or a quick spray of cleaner. Over-cleaning or using excessive moisture can harm the laminate’s core, so always use a damp, not soaking wet, mop or cloth. Regular maintenance helps keep floors looking bright and extends their lifespan.
Are spray cleaners better than concentrates for laminate floors?
Spray cleaners offer convenience and quick application, making them ideal for spot cleaning or daily maintenance. Concentrates, on the other hand, tend to be more economical over time and can be diluted for larger areas. The choice depends on your cleaning frequency and preference for ease versus cost. Keep in mind that concentrates require mixing, which adds a step, but they often provide better value per use.
Will using a steam mop damage my laminate floors?
Steam mops are generally not recommended for laminate floors because the high heat and moisture can cause the laminate to swell or warp. If you prefer steam cleaning, ensure the device is specifically designed for laminate and use it sparingly. For most homeowners, a damp microfiber mop with a suitable laminate cleaner yields safer, effective results without risking damage.
What ingredients should I avoid in laminate floor cleaners?
Avoid cleaners with harsh chemicals such as ammonia, bleach, or abrasive detergents, as these can strip or dull the laminate surface. Additionally, steer clear of oil-based or wax-based products that can leave residues or create a slippery surface. Always check labels for safe, non-abrasive, and pH-balanced formulas designed explicitly for laminate floors to prevent long-term damage.
